Transaction 65e27fa718ecf95cfe81cac0697f3ea345da7d3612fecbaf69c38852e9e2b580
1 Input
1 Output
-
65e27fa718ecf95cfe81cac0697f3ea345da7d3612fecbaf69c38852e9e2b580:0
- value
- 261603
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51984abb29a308628f89a2eb3c78849a1106020a OP_EQUAL
- address
- 398T6WXw1AzU8EixjQ4cnx8xxBQoUyAYgj